The first major case of HIV / AIDS history began in the early 1980s with gay men in New York and California. Back then, after the incident had been linked, AIDS did not even have a name even in the United States. The origin of HIV is thought to be the descendant of similar diseases that affect primate or simian immunodeficiency virus. This was discovered in a 10-year virus study by the research team at the University of Alabama in 1999.

The activist group works to prevent the spread of HIV by distributing information on safe sex. They are also used to support HIV / AIDS patients, provide treatment, support the group, and provide hospice care. To meet the needs of certain people living with HIV / AIDS, organizations such as gay health crisis, lesbian AIDS program, and sister love were created. Another group like the NAMES project is to celebrate the passing people and refuse to let them forget by historical stories. The drug abuse prevention and treatment association (ADAPT) led by Yolanda Serrano will contact the local prison Riker Island correctional facility, appeal for the early release of prisons and HIV positive people and let them die in comfortable homes
